- 5 January 1926: Mineworker Injured – An Alarming accident happened at the Brighill Colliery on Tuesday as the result of which Mr Ben Flannigan (33), 110 Auchterderran Road, is confined to his bed in a critical condition. The injured man was employed on the surface at the “fire holes” His work was to remove the dross from the waggons in the holes. On Tuesday he was cleaning the rails after having emptied one of the waggons, when, unseen by him, the engine approached and knocked him over. His back was thought at first to be broken but on examination it was found to be only severely bruised. His chest was also injured through his being thrown on some projecting girders. [Dunfermline Journal 9 January 1926]
